Source-Code-Management
Build Tools
Continuous-Integration
Configuration / Provisioning
Containerization
Monitoring
DevOps is an increasingly common approach to agile software development that developers and operations teams use to build, test, deploy and monitor applications with speed, quality and control.
DevOps is relevant to any kind of software project regardless of architecture, platform or purpose. Common use cases include: cloud-native and mobile applications, application integration, and modernization and multicloud management.
Successful DevOps implementations generally rely on an integrated set of solutions or a "toolchain" to remove manual steps, reduce errors, increase team agility, and to scale beyond small, isolated teams. Learn more about our solutions such as release automation, service virtualization and application performance management.